Abstract
This paper presents studies of some anomalies observed in kinetics of fission products based
on the model of porous fuel. A nonmonotone two-peak structure of a fission product flux is
shown to be determined by the effect of the system of open pores. It has been established that
on heating, an explosive growth of a flux in the region of relatively high temperatures is
associated with a high nonlinearity of the time dependence of phenomenological parameters
describing a fission gas release from a solid phase. The analysis has been performed. of the
processes accompanying a decay of a fission product solid solution. The possibility of a fuel
material dispersion has been noted under the conditions of a fast reactivity accident due to a
sharp rise of the gas phase pressure in the system of closed pores.
